Ideal Soil Type
Characteristics of Best Soil π±
When it comes to groundnut cultivation, sandy loam is the gold standard. This soil type strikes a perfect balance between drainage and nutrient retention, making it ideal for healthy plant growth.
Equally important is the soil structure. Well-aerated soil encourages robust root development, allowing plants to access water and nutrients more efficiently.
Importance of Soil Texture and Structure ποΈ
Good drainage is crucial for preventing waterlogging, a condition that can lead to root rot. Without proper drainage, your groundnuts may struggle to thrive.
Aeration plays a vital role as well. It facilitates essential gas exchange, which is critical for maintaining healthy roots and overall plant vitality.
Soil pH
Recommended pH Range π±
For groundnuts to thrive, aim for a soil pH between 6.0 and 6.5. This range is crucial for optimal growth and nutrient uptake, ensuring your plants get the nourishment they need.
Effects of pH on Growth βοΈ
Soils that are too acidic, with a pH below 6.0, can cause nutrient deficiencies, especially in phosphorus. On the flip side, alkaline soils above 6.5 can hinder nitrogen fixation, which is vital for the overall health of your groundnuts.
Understanding the pH of your soil is essential for successful groundnut cultivation. By maintaining the right pH, you set the stage for robust growth and a bountiful harvest.

Creating a Homemade Soil Mix ((difficulty:easy))
π± Ingredients for an Ideal Mix
Creating the perfect soil mix for groundnuts is straightforward and rewarding. Start with 50% sandy loam soil, which provides excellent drainage.
Next, add 30% compost to boost nutrient content. Finally, incorporate 20% perlite or vermiculite to enhance aeration, ensuring your plants have the best environment to thrive.
π οΈ Step-by-Step Guide
Follow these simple steps to create your homemade soil mix:
- Gather materials: Collect sandy loam, compost, and perlite or vermiculite.
- Combine base ingredients: In a large container, mix the sandy loam and compost thoroughly.
- Add aeration amendments: Gradually blend in perlite or vermiculite until the mixture is uniform.
- Test the pH: Finally, check the pH of your mix to confirm it falls within the ideal range of 6.0 to 6.5.

Soil Amendments
Common Amendments π±
When it comes to improving your groundnut soil, amendments play a crucial role.
- Lime is your go-to if your soil is too acidic, as it raises the pH to create a more balanced environment.
- Sulfur works in the opposite direction, lowering pH levels if your soil is too alkaline.
- Organic fertilizers are fantastic for enhancing nutrient availability, ensuring your plants have what they need to thrive.
Incorporating Amendments π οΈ
To effectively incorporate these amendments, start by determining what your soil needs through a soil test.
- Determine the need for amendments based on soil test results.
- Evenly distribute amendments over the soil surface to ensure uniformity.
- Use a garden fork or tiller to mix amendments into the top 6-8 inches of soil, allowing them to integrate well.
By following these steps, youβll create a nutrient-rich environment that supports healthy groundnut growth.

Soil Drainage
Importance of Drainage π
Proper drainage is crucial for groundnut cultivation. It prevents waterlogging, which can lead to root rot and other diseases that threaten plant health.
Healthy drainage also supports the unique growth habit of groundnuts. Since their pods develop underground, adequate drainage ensures that roots can thrive without excess moisture.
Solutions for Improving Drainage π§
There are several effective strategies to enhance soil drainage.
Raised Beds ποΈ
Creating raised beds is a simple yet effective method. Elevating the soil helps improve drainage, allowing excess water to flow away from the roots.
Adding Organic Matter π±
Incorporating organic matter into your soil can significantly boost its structure. This not only improves drainage capacity but also enriches the soil with nutrients.
Installing Drainage Tiles π§±
For those dealing with heavy soils, installing drainage tiles can be a game changer. These tiles help manage excess water, ensuring that your groundnuts have the ideal environment for growth.
By focusing on these drainage solutions, you can create a thriving habitat for your groundnuts. This sets the stage for healthy plants and a bountiful harvest.
